"I went back to film work after Dobie. I went back to film work after Dobie"

- Dwayne Hickman

About this Quote

Dwayne Hickman is an American actor who is best known for his function as Dobie Gillis in the tv series The Many Loves of Dobie Gillis. In this quote, Hickman is referring to his career after the show ended. After Dobie Gillis ended, Hickman returned to movie work. This most likely means that he went back to acting in movies, rather than television. He may have been referring to his functions in movies such as The Ghost and Mr. Chicken, The Love God?, and The Boatniks. Hickman likewise continued to act in television, appearing in shows such as The Bob Newhart Show, The Love Boat, and Fantasy Island. He also had a repeating function in the show Dallas. After Dobie Gillis, Hickman continued to have a successful career in both movie and television.
